An Osaka school ivory netsuke of a toy figurine of an ox. Mid-19th century

Standing, looking straight ahead, showing the protruding seams that joined the two halves of the clay model. Signed Mitsusada in seal form.
Height 2.9 cm; length 4.3 cm

These clay figurines (tsuchi-ningyo) were regional souvenirs of the Fushimi Inari Shrine and a popular subject of the Osaka netsuke carvers.
